The Pfarrkirche Maria Hilf in Bamberg, Germany, is a significant neo-Gothic Roman Catholic parish church situated at an elevation of 241 metres in the city's Wunderburg district. Dedicated to Mary, Help of Christians, this historical site is renowned for its architectural beauty and its role as a local pilgrimage destination within the Upper Franconia region of Bavaria.

The Pfarrkirche Maria Hilf in Bamberg is a significant example of Neo-Gothic architecture. It was designed by architect Chrysostom Martin and consecrated in 1889, reflecting the revival of Gothic forms popular in the late 19th century.

The heart of the church is the venerated miraculous image of "Maria Hilf". This is a plastic copy of Lucas Cranach's famous painting from Innsbruck. It was carefully transferred from the demolished baroque Maria Hilf pilgrimage chapel, continuing a spiritual legacy that draws pilgrims, such as those from Unterstürmig, who have visited for over 150 years on Assumption Day.
